Output c0660065102b91c144498c20bdd21b2300457706e32bcd0e74e537be234f80dd:0

value
36964685
script pubkey
OP_0 OP_PUSHBYTES_20 943969736b8b7c2604c6336e8a0f4267904e47fc
address
ltc1qjsukjumt3d7zvpxxxdhg5r6zv7gyu3luqjhchc
transaction
c0660065102b91c144498c20bdd21b2300457706e32bcd0e74e537be234f80dd
spent
true